首頁 > web前端 > js教程 > 主體

JS正規驗證信箱的格式詳細介紹_javascript技巧

WBOY
發布: 2016-05-16 17:14:17
原創
1071 人瀏覽過

對於我們做WEB開發的,對表單的驗證是必不可少的,所以今天把常用的一些驗證羅列出來,呵呵,今天下午剛學的JS正則表達式,有什麼不足的地方還希望大家批評指正。

一.相關的程式碼

複製程式碼 代碼如下:
function test()
 {
  var temp()
 {
  var temp()
 {
  var temp = document.getElementById("text1");
  //電子郵件的驗證
 -9] [_|/_|/.]?)*[a-zA-Z0-9] @([a-zA-Z0-9] [_|/_|/.]?)*[a- zA-Z0-9] /.[a-zA-Z]{2,3}$/;
  if(!myreg.test(temp.value))
  {
    alert('提示/ n/n請輸入有效的E_mail!正規表示式
 //對於手機號碼的驗證(提供了兩種方法)
 var mobile=/^((13[0-9]{1})|159|153) /d{8} $/;
 var mobile1=/^(13 /d{9})|(159 /d{8})|(153 /d{8})$/;
 //對於區號的驗證
 var phoneAreaNum = /^/d{3,4}$/;
 //對於電話號碼的驗證
 var phone =/^/d{7,8}$/;
}



二.解釋相關的意義

1.  /^$/ 這個是個通用的格式。      ^ 符合輸入字串的起始位置;$符合輸入字串的結束位置
2. 裡面輸入需要實現的功能。
    * 配對前面的子表達式零次或多次;
    配對前面的子表達式一次或多次;
    ?匹配前面的子表達式零次或一次;
    /d  匹配一個數字字符,等價於[0-9]
相關標籤:
js
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
最新問題
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板